Brooks Announces $350,000 Grant to Improve Trail in Hermitage

State Sen. Michele Brooks (R-50) today announced that $350,000 from PennDOT’s Multimodal Transportation Fund will be used to enhance trail connections near the Hermitage Athletics Complex. This includes a new trail head parking area, expanded trails and improvements to Lorenwood Drive.  [Read More]

Senate Passes Brooks’ Bill to Improve Newborn Safety

HARRISBURG – To protect babies with parents who are unable to care for them, the Senate unanimously passed legislation sponsored by Sen. Michele Brooks (R-50). Senate Bill 267 would decriminalize surrendering an unharmed newborn at an urgent care center when a parent is unable to care for a child.
